WARNING : this version is ment for high greater rifts, this build is not as efficient at easy content like torment 6, for an extremely efficient T6 whirlwind spec, check out http://www.diablofans.com/builds/53881-t6-speedfarm-whirlwind-ik-bk
The items for this build are relatively set in stone, except for 1 ring, amulet, and bracers.
You need Immortal king Weapon and Belt, and you need The wastes set Shoulders.
Between gloves/helm/chest/legs/boots, you need 1 IK piece and 4 waste pieces.
One ring has to be the ring of royal grandeur and I definitely recommend unity for the second ring, although stone of jordan or convention of elements is a decent choice if you prefer some more damage, or if you're running in a party.
The best amulet is either a hellfire maulet or an immunity amulet, no other amulets really have useful legendary effects for the build.
The best bracer is either one of the bracers that roll attack speed, or reaper's wraps to keep up max fury easier.
Take physical damage % on bracers, and possibly on the amulet ( Physical - crit chance - crit damage - socket ), although physical or strength being better on the neck is debatable, exspecially if the necklace is ancient. Physical damage % will give you more damage than strength, but strength is also giving you a lot of toughness in the form of armour.
Life and vitality rolls are pretty good as our healing from the whirlwind rune is based on life %, and we have room for a life gem in the helmet since we don't need CDR at all, making us able to get a pretty high amount of life.
The 3 best legendary gems are Baned of the trapped, Taeguk and Pain enhancer, For damage I can't imagine any other combination being stronger damage wise, although a very high rank Esoteric Alteration could be a swap for the bane of the trapped gem if you want to become even more tanky.
If you want to go really advanced, here's the whirlwind breakpoints : http://i.imgur.com/3BmaOqd.png
What this means is , to give a random example. Having 2.25 Attacks per second is exactly the same for whirlwind as having 2.40 attacks per second, as they're in the same breakpoint range. At those points you can either drop some attack speed without losing aything, or get some more to hit the next breakpoint.
The reason why the breakpoint thing is hard to balance for this build is because of pain enhancer, what some people like to do is to balance the breakpoints around havingg one stack of pain enhancer, so they're balanced for the rift guardian.

Build Guide
After testing multiple whirlwind versions I believe this is currently the strongest whirlwind build in the game
The build is godlike at clearing trash mobs and is pretty slow at rift guardians, getting to really high Greater rift records is going to require some praying to RNGesus, certain rift guardians will go much slower than others. I can consistently clear GR47's without Requiring RNG, using a very bad gearset. With close to best in slot gear this build will be able to consistently clear GR50 and With great pylons, rift Guardian, and mob type/density, I fully expect somebody to push 56-57 with this build.
The gameplay is honestly pretty damn simple, you keep whirlwinding to keep up your taeguk gem and your 40% damage reduction from the wastes set, generally you never drop whirlwind during an entire rift, except for long dead ends.
Whenever you're in the middle of a pack, drop a rend, this has two reasons, it's a nice extra damage source as it's greatly amplified by the 2 set wastes bonus, and it also counts as a fury spending attack, which triggers the immortal king 4 set bonus and reduces the berserker/ancients cooldown by 3 seconds for every 10 fury spent. Using only whirlwind will NOT spend enough fury to keep berserker up constantly, you have to rend to keep it up, so sometimes it's worth it to rend targets that are already bleeding, just to spend some more fury to lower your cooldowns, You'll eventually get used to this and find a balanced amount of rending to keep up Your super saiyan mode while not dropping too much in fury. Having 800 paragon for some free cooldown reduction in paragon also helps a bit, but I don't recommend ever dropping the life% gem in the helm or crit/attack speed to get CDR.
Battle rage only once every 120 seconds, battle rage is not an attack so it will not trigger your IK 4 set, you only use it for the buff.
Use warcry whenever the buff is about to fall off or whenever you're falling below max fury. Warcry is not an entirely mandatory skill for this build though, some people prefer running sprint or Overpower - killing spree.
Ancients are cast once, and only need to be recast when they die.
Wrath of the berserker should be kept up at all time, never let it fall off.

When pushing grifts higher, I use unity over my awesome coe. Surprised you got that far without it. From my experience, you want a 50% reduction from one of two places. Wotb Rune or from Unity. I would never have gotten to 51 without it. In fact, I wont even enter a 40+ without it. Of course, if you are in a group, unity is out of the question, so adjust to your group on whether you need striding giant. Side note, you shouldn't need weapons master with reapers wraps. I personally use the rune with battle rage to make health globes drop like candy then make up the damage with a passive like rampage which also helps survivability.
Choice 1: Coe + striding giant rune.
*Able to predict and burst with coe buff. Very hard to recover from a death since your mitigation requires wotb off cooldown. Less room for error with wotb uptime.
Choice 2: Unity + Insanity rune.
*More steady damage across the board. 50% damage at all times but you cant predict a burst. Faster recovery from wipe since you already have your 50% reduction you wont get instagibbed as easy. Wotb falls off for a couple seconds is NOT the end of the world.*
Either way the choice lands with a 50% damage 50% reduction. From your link, you are going 100% damage and committing suicide.
